Cisco Catalyst 9200 Series Switches

FIPS 140-2 certificate #4556 · Cisco Systems, Inc. · data as of 2026-08-28
Historical. Moved to historical list due to sunsetting. Federal agencies may reference historical validations for existing systems only, not for new procurement.
Caveat: When operated in FIPS mode, installed, initialized and configured as specified in Section 3 of the Security Policy. This module contains the embedded module 'ACT2Lite Cryptographic Module' validated to FIPS 140-2 under Cert. #3637 operating in FIPS mode

Module description

With full PoE+ capability, power and fan redundancy, stacking bandwidth up to 160 Gbps, modular uplinks, Layer 3 feature support, and cold patching, Catalyst 9200 Series switches are the industry's unparalleled solution with differentiated resiliency and progressive architecture for cost-effective branch-office access. The switches meet FIPS 140-2 overall Level 1 requirements as multi-chip standalone modules. Advanced security feature supports IOS-XE software, MACsec encryption, hardware anchored secure boot, Secure Unique Device Identification (SUDI) support.

Security level exceptions

  • Roles, Services, and Authentication: Level 3
  • Design Assurance: Level 2
  • Mitigation of Other Attacks: N/A
